Wild Wadi Waterpark Dubai is one of the city’s most iconic water parks, located in Jumeirah with breathtaking views of the Burj Al Arab. Inspired by the Arabian folklore character Juha, the park offers an exciting mix of high-speed water slides, wave pools, lazy rivers, and family-friendly attractions. With more than 30 rides suitable for all age groups, Wild Wadi is the perfect destination for thrill-seekers, families, and water lovers. Wild Wadi Waterpark is located in the Jumeirah area of Dubai, right next to the iconic Burj Al Arab, making it one of the most scenic waterparks in the city.

Yes, Wild Wadi is suitable for children of various age groups. The park features dedicated kids’ play areas, gentle slides, and shallow pools designed for younger visitors, while adults can enjoy thrill rides.

Most visitors spend around 4 to 6 hours at Wild Wadi, depending on crowd levels, ride queues, and time spent relaxing or dining.

No, food and beverages are not included in the ticket price. However, Wild Wadi offers multiple restaurants and snack counters serving a variety of meals and refreshments.

Yes, Wild Wadi is an outdoor waterpark. Visitors are advised to wear sunscreen, stay hydrated, and plan visits during comfortable weather hours.
